Overview
Request 585034 superseded
Initial Factory submission. https://lists.opensuse.org/opensuse-factory/2018-03/msg00084.html
- Created by jfajerski
- In state superseded
- Supersedes 583785 583875
- Superseded by 707082
- Open review for repo-checker
Eh it's not such a good idea to copy-paste the git log... not in that length.
Maybe rather a link to the upstream change log? https://github.com/grafana/grafana/blob/v5.0.0/CHANGELOG.md
Along with packaging changes.
https://en.opensuse.org/openSUSE:Creating_a_changes_file_%28RPM%29#What_goes_into_the_changelog for more details about a good changelog entry.
Request History
jfajerski created request
Initial Factory submission. https://lists.opensuse.org/opensuse-factory/2018-03/msg00084.html
licensedigger accepted review
ok
factory-auto added opensuse-review-team as a reviewer
Please review sources
factory-auto added repo-checker as a reviewer
Please review build success
factory-auto accepted review
Check script succeeded
staging-bot added openSUSE:Factory:Staging:adi:53 as a reviewer
Being evaluated by staging project "openSUSE:Factory:Staging:adi:53"
staging-bot accepted review
Picked openSUSE:Factory:Staging:adi:53
dimstar accepted review
dimstar_suse added openSUSE:Factory:Staging:adi:23 as a reviewer
Being evaluated by staging project "openSUSE:Factory:Staging:adi:23"
dimstar_suse accepted review
Moved to openSUSE:Factory:Staging:adi:23
dimstar_suse accepted review
Reviewed by staging project "openSUSE:Factory:Staging:adi:23" with result: "accepted"
dimstar_suse added factory-staging as a reviewer
Please recheck
dimstar_suse added as a reviewer
Being evaluated by staging project "openSUSE:Factory:Staging:adi:70"
dimstar_suse accepted review
Picked openSUSE:Factory:Staging:adi:70
dimstar declined review
nothing provides phantomjs
dimstar declined request
nothing provides phantomjs
@jfajerski see staging project comments by myself and repo-checker.
nothing provides phantomjs
This was noted before. From my understanding phantomjs is an optional dependency used to generate pngs of the graphs on demand. If you do not need pngs you do not need phantomjs.
Since upstream will have to deal with this anyway, how about we change to recommends for now.
Afaiu the grafana build process does not allow for phantomjs to be optional. Rather the grafana sources come with a pre-build binary (which we don't use, hence the dependency). I have not tested grafana without phantomjs.
So what's the conclusion? I see three choices:
@dimstart fwiw I'm tracking Grafana, the phantomjs dependency will be dropped before long.